C语言作为一种历史悠久且功能强大的编程语言,被广泛应用于系统软件、嵌入式系统、游戏开发等领域。对于小学生来说,学习C语言不仅能培养逻辑思维能力,还能激发他们对计算机科学的兴趣。以下是一份精心准备的C语言入门宝典,包含精选资源,帮助小学生轻松入门。
一、C语言基础知识
1.1 变量和数据类型
- 变量:在程序中用来存储数据的容器,如
int a;表示定义了一个整型变量a。 - 数据类型:包括整型、浮点型、字符型等,用于指定变量的存储方式和占用内存空间。
1.2 运算符
- 算术运算符:加、减、乘、除等。
- 赋值运算符:用于给变量赋值,如
a = 5;。 - 关系运算符:大于、小于、等于等。
- 逻辑运算符:与、或、非等。
1.3 控制结构
- 顺序结构:按照代码编写的顺序执行。
- 选择结构:根据条件判断执行不同的代码块,如
if语句。 - 循环结构:重复执行某段代码,如
for和while循环。
二、C语言编程实例
2.1 计算两个数的和
#include <stdio.h>
int main() {
int a, b, sum;
printf("请输入两个数:");
scanf("%d %d", &a, &b);
sum = a + b;
printf("两数之和为:%d\n", sum);
return 0;
}
2.2 判断一个数是否为偶数
#include <stdio.h>
int main() {
int num;
printf("请输入一个数:");
scanf("%d", &num);
if (num % 2 == 0) {
printf("%d 是偶数\n", num);
} else {
printf("%d 是奇数\n", num);
}
return 0;
}
三、C语言学习资源推荐
3.1 在线教程
- C语言中文网:提供丰富的C语言教程和实例。
- 菜鸟教程:涵盖C语言基础知识、编程实例等。
3.2 编程网站
- LeetCode:提供大量编程题库,适合练习C语言编程。
- Codeforces:一个国际性的编程竞赛平台,可以锻炼编程能力。
3.3 编程书籍
- 《C程序设计语言》(K&R):被誉为C语言入门经典。
- 《C Primer Plus》:适合有一定基础的读者深入学习。
四、学习建议
- 多动手实践,通过编写代码来巩固所学知识。
- 参加编程比赛,提高自己的编程能力。
- 关注编程领域的最新动态,不断学习新知识。
通过以上资源,相信小学生们能够轻松入门C语言编程,开启自己的编程之旅。祝大家学习愉快!
